Mrs. Gertrude Jeffries Hailey, 86, of 906 Midland Drive, Wilmington, d i e d Saturday, November 11, 1995, at the Mariner Health Care Center. M r s . Hailey was born June 12, 1909, in Rockingham County, N.C., the daug h t er of the late Payton and Ollie Pearl Martin Jeffries. She received h e r e ducation in the Leaksville School System and later attended the Ple a s ant Hill Academy in Pleasant Hill, Tennessee. She was a member of the F i r st Baptist Church, where she devoted much of her time to the developm e n t of the Lake Forest Baptist and Murrayville Baptist Churches and oth e r c hurch organizations. She particularly encouraged the youth to atten d c h urch and be active in the youth programs. She was also a member of t h e S unset Park Home Demonstration Club and the secretary and treasurer o f t h e Sunset Garden Club. Mrs. Hailey was a devoted wife, mother an d h o memaker and was very supportive of her children when they were in s ch o ol and active in the Band clubs. Survivors include her husband, P e r cy Eugene Hailey of the home; two sons, Ronald E. Hailey of Clayton, N . C ., Michael R. Hailey of Raleigh; one daughter, Barbara H. Robbins of W i l mington; five grandchildren, Scott A. Robbins, David Keith Hailey, Ki m b erly H. Meier, Amanda L. Hailey and Jeff R. Hailey; and five great-gr a n dchildren. Funeral services will be held at 11 a.m. Tuesday, Nove m b er 14, 1995, in the Coble Ward-Smith Funeral Service, Oleander Chapel b y t h e Reverend Jim Everette. The interment will be in Greenlawn Memoria l P a rk.
